美文网首页Web前端之路
Mac创建跨域Chrome快捷启动方式

Mac创建跨域Chrome快捷启动方式

作者: revert | 来源:发表于2018-03-12 00:41 被阅读135次

前端er开发通常避不开跨域问题,开发阶段,本地代码访问服务器接口会提示跨域,无法获取到想要的数据。之前用Windows开发可以很好的解决,安装Chrome,然后在快捷方式右键属性,在目标一栏最后添加 --args --disable-web-security 即可,有两种版本设置方式,这里不做过多说明。但是Mac上的跨域就没那么方便了,因为应用启动不再是像Windows的快捷方式了,也没有属性了,只能在终端用命令行打开跨域模式,命令如下(需替换路径中的yourname):

open -n /Applications/Google\ Chrome.app/ --args --disable-web-security --user-data-dir=/Users/yourname/MyChromeDevUserData/

每次开启跨域都需要重新敲命令,比较麻烦,下面介绍一种简单的方式,利用Mac自带的automator创建一个应用程序。


  1. command+ 空格打开,输入automator回车打开automator

  2. 选择应用程序,点击选取


  3. 选择实用工具中的shell脚本,双击之后输入

open -n /Applications/Google\ Chrome.app/ --args --disable-web-security --user-data-dir=/Users/yourname/MyChromeDevUserData/

  1. 关闭并重命名,保存到应用程序,点击存储



    这时候就可以Launchpad种看到创建的应用了


  2. 为了以后启动方便可以拖动到程序坞中保留

至此,跨域Chrome的快捷启动方式就完成了!

相关文章

  • Mac创建跨域Chrome快捷启动方式

    前端er开发通常避不开跨域问题,开发阶段,本地代码访问服务器接口会提示跨域,无法获取到想要的数据。之前用Windo...

  • chrome跨域设置

    chrome跨域访问接口 点击桌面chrome的快捷方式,右键->属性->目标C:\Users\Administr...

  • 解决浏览器跨域访问

    前言 直接关闭浏览器的跨域检测。 方法 新建一个Chrome浏览器快捷方式。 右击,属性,修改启动参数 设置启动参数

  • 跨域的解决

    1.chrome浏览器解决跨域问题 右击chrome图标 选择属性 快捷方式 在目标末尾位置,空格,输入--arg...

  • 谷歌浏览器基础问题

    谷歌浏览器设置跨域方法 在桌面找到chrome快捷方式,右键“属性”,“快捷方式”选项卡里选择“目标”,添加如下代码

  • 谷歌浏览器(chrome)允许跨域设置

    一、设置跨域,在chrome快捷方式右键‘属性’,‘快捷方式’,‘目标’ 路径最后边按一下空格,再添加以下代码: ...

  • Mac Chrome 谷歌浏览器跨域解决

    Mac Chrome 谷歌浏览器跨域问题解决!1.复制代码,创建一个 Chrome.command文件 2.制...

  • 本地调试 -- Mac Chrome 解决跨域-CORS-问题

    一般本地调试的时候,某些资源需要开启跨域访问mac chrome浏览器解决跨域(CORS)问题, 跨域直接使用插件...

  • 解决Chrome,FireFox跨域问题

    1. 解决Chrome跨域问题 Mac 终端运行 Chrome(推介使用默认用户目录): Chrome(指定用户目...

  • Chrome免跨域(仅调试)

    本地开发时,需要使用非安全模式,避免跨域英影响 在chrome快捷方式的目标后面加( --disable-web-...

网友评论

    本文标题:Mac创建跨域Chrome快捷启动方式

    本文链接:https://www.haomeiwen.com/subject/pelifftx.html